A Brief History of Gold
Gold has been a symbol of wealth and power for thousands of years. Ancient civilizations, from the Egyptians to the Romans, adorned themselves with gold and used it as currency. Just think about it: in the past, people went to great lengths to mine gold and create intricate jewelry and artifacts. Fast forward to today, and here we are still valuing it just as much!
The allure of gold is not just about its shiny appearance. It was a medium of exchange long before paper money came into existence. When currencies were based on commodities, gold stood out due to its durability, divisibility, and scarcity. Even as we transitioned into a world dominated by paper and digital currency, gold maintained its reputation as a safe-haven asset.
Gold’s Role in the Modern Economy
In today's world, one might wonder, "Why should I invest in gold?" The answer lies in its characteristics as a hedge against inflation and economic downturns. When the economy takes a hit, currencies often lose their value. This is where gold shines (pun intended). Unlike paper money, gold is a tangible asset that tends to retain its value, making it a go-to option for investors.
For instance, during the 2008 financial crisis, while many investments faltered, gold prices soared. Investors flocked to the metal, boosting its perceived value. People often turn to gold in times of uncertainty, whether it's due to geopolitical tensions, economic recessions, or even global pandemics. It's almost like a safety blanket for your portfolio!
The Psychological Appeal of Gold
Part of the charm of gold lies in human psychology. Gold is often associated with wealth, success, and stability. This psychological connection influences how people view it in times of crisis. When anxiety reigns supreme, many individuals gravitate towards gold as a source of security.
The steady demand for gold jewelry also fuels its popularity. Across cultures, gold jewelry is not just about aesthetics; it's often considered a family heirloom or a significant investment. The emotional and cultural significance attached to gold adds layers to its value that mere numbers can't capture.
Gold vs. Other Investments
You might be wondering how gold stacks up against other investments. Stocks, bonds, real estate—they all have their place in a well-rounded portfolio. However, gold has a unique edge: it’s not directly tied to any economy or governmental policy. While stocks can plummet due to political debates or economic downturns, gold remains a tangible asset that can hold value regardless of the situation.
Moreover, gold behaves differently compared to traditional investments. It often moves inversely to the stock market. So, if you’re looking to balance your portfolio, including gold can provide some cushioning against volatility!

Investing in Gold Wisely
So, if you’re considering adding gold to your investment portfolio, how do you go about it? There are several ways to invest in gold, whether it’s buying physical gold in the form of bars or coins or investing in gold ETFs and mining stocks. Each option has its own benefits and risks, so be sure to do your homework!
